    If Washington doesn't want to go, the club could still deregister him and leave him to play in the u21's for the rest of the season, sure there would be a hit on wages but hey that happens sometimes. otherwise a mutual termination of contract is an option.

    Ward's issue is he has hardly been fit, but then that applies to a number of others. I think its a wee bit insulting to Warne to blame warne for the injury problems with loan players. A loan player is often a gamble, one can get a higher quality player than the club can afford, but often the reason that players is available is due to injuries/fitness issues. Even with a rising young star the gamble may not be fitness, but can he adjust to the higher level of competitive football.

    Given derby are still operating at a level below many of the championship rivals, my view is that overall the recruitment has bee good. Good enough to secure promotion in the 2nd season after administration and good enough to at present only be on the fringes of a relegation battle.

    If (unlikely) no plyer comes in, then I still think we would survive, but it will be rather more comfortable if we can get a couple in.
